McNab vs Mudi vs Australian Shepherd Size and Weight Comparison
Size Classification
Compare size differences between McNab, Mudi, and Australian Shepherd. Which breed is the largest? | Medium | Medium | Large |
---|---|---|---|
Weight Statistics
How do weights compare between McNab, Mudi, and Australian Shepherd? Compare adult weight ranges. | Male: 35-65 lbs (16-30 kg), Female: 30-50 lbs (14-23 kg) | 18-29 pounds (8-13 kg) | Male: 50-65 pounds (25-29 kg), Female: 40-55 pounds (18-25 kg) |
Average Weight
Which dog has a smaller / higher average weight? | Male: 35-65 lbs (23 kg), Female: 30-50 lbs (18.5 kg) | 23.5 pounds (10.5 kg) | Male: 57.5 pounds (27 kg), Female: 47.5 pounds (21.5 kg) |
Height
Which is taller, McNab or Mudi or Australian Shepherd? McNab vs Mudi vs Australian Shepherd height comparison: | Male: 18-25 inches (45-64 cm), Female: 16-21 inches (40-54 cm) | 15-19 inches (38-48 cm) | Male: 20-23 inches (52-58cm), Female: 18-21 inches (46–53 cm) |
Average Height
Which dog has a smaller / higher average height? | Male: 21.5 inches (54.5 cm), Female: 18.5 inches (47 cm) | 17 inches (43 cm) | Male: 21.5 inches (55 cm), Female: 19.5 inches (46–53 cm) |

McNab vs Mudi vs Australian Shepherd Recognition Comparison
AKC Classification
Compare AKC groups for McNab, Mudi, and Australian Shepherd. How are they classified? | Not recognized by the American Kennel Club. | Recognized by the American Kennel Club as a Miscellaneous breed. | Recognized by the American Kennel Club in 1991 as a Herding breed. |
---|---|---|---|
FCI Classification
Compare FCI groups for McNab, Mudi, and Australian Shepherd. How are they classified internationally? | Not recognized by FCI. | Recognized by FCI in the Sheepdogs and Cattledogs (except Swiss Cattledogs) group, in the Sheepdogs section. | Recognized by FCI in the Sheepdogs and Cattledogs (except Swiss Cattledogs) group, in the Sheepdogs section. |
